Building a Business Case 27.12.2023

First things first, why do we need to have clear, compelling business cases when we’re trying to get an idea adopted, an initiative started, a project funded…whatever it happens to be? A business case is essential because it justifies expenditures of time, talent and other resources. It also forecasts the outcomes you’re going to deliver. Underperforming Teams 13.12.2023

Just like there are underperforming managers, there are underperforming teams. What does an underperforming team look like? Two of the obvious indicators are that they can’t meet deadlines and their deliverables are substandard. Yes, they’re late and what they produce wasn’t worth waiting for.
